Two luscious Southern French reds kick off the celebrations in your Full Flavour Celebration Dozen! The mighty Le XV du Président 2023 (our ‘King of the Big Reds’) owes its intensity to 100-year-old Grenache vines growing on the rocky slopes of the Pyrenean foothills. The velvety Château de Lastours Grand Vin 2018 is a mature blend from one of Corbières’ top estates. Buyer Mark Hoddy called it one of his Best Buys of the year!

To Italy’s Puglia next, for the Gold-winning Corsiero Nero Purosangue 2024, a racy black red of incredible intensity. Our customers adore this feisty, headstrong star!

Then, to Spain’s renowned Priorat region, home to “arrestingly concentrated” wines (Jancis Robinson). Selección Especial Numerada 66 Priorat 2021 is a secret label wine with Gold & 95pts from one of the most awarded wineries in the region, opposite which lies L’Ermita, which fetches $10,000 a bottle. It’s a fabulous, rich red – a blend of dark, swarthy Garnacha, Samsó (aka Carignan), Syrah and Merlot – amazing!

Not to be outdone is the sumptuous Stone Pine Cabernet Sauvignon 2022 from Navarra near Rioja, which also boasts Gold and 95pts. It’s lavishly dark and intense.

Last, to Australia, for the flavour-packed FOUR Gold-winning Q Malbec 2024 from “magician” (James Halliday) John Quarisa. It’s a true blue, BIG Aussie beauty!
